What we do:
The Markets Group at the Federal Reserve Bank of New York implements monetary policy on behalf of the Federal Reserve System (FRS) and acts as fiscal agent for the U.S. Treasury Department. As part of these responsibilities, the Market Operations Monitoring and Analysis Function (MOMA) within the Markets Group executes transactions in the open market and conducts detailed analysis of financial market developments to support monetary policy and financial stability decision-making process.
The Mortgage Markets (MM) team monitors and analyzes mortgage markets to inform the formulation and implementation of monetary and financial stability policy. We conduct agency mortgage backed securities (MBS) and agency commercial backed securities (CMBS) operations based on the FOMC's directives. We also regularly speak to market participants to gather market intelligence, analyze data, and produce internal research publications to inform the formulation and implementation of monetary policy.
